    Auto Locksmiths Can Help When You're Locked Out of Your Car

    Land-Rover.pngThere are few things more stressful than being locked out of your vehicle. Locksmiths can help if you've locked keys in the car or are stuck at the mall.

    Damaged Ignition

    It's a harrowing feeling to put your key into the ignition and it isn't turning. This could mean that your ignition cylinder is damaged or the switch that controls it is malfunctioning. In these situations, it is important to contact a professional take your vehicle to a mechanic as soon as possible. If you try to fix the issue yourself, it's possible that you could worsen the damage and eventually have to purchase a completely new ignition.

    A local auto locksmith can help you in this situation and help you get your vehicle back on the road. They have the knowledge and equipment required to replace the ignition of your car should it be required. They can also rekey locks so that you only need one key to unlock all of your doors. Thumbtack's reviews as well as profiles can help you find a reputable locksmith for your car.

    If your car's keys won't move, it's likely that the ignition cylinder has been bent. This is a serious problem that requires the knowledge and experience of an experienced automotive locksmith. If you're not a locksmith you should never attempt to straighten out your key using pliers or other tools made of metal that could lead to further damage. It is recommended to contact an emergency locksmith so that they can utilize the appropriate tools and techniques to remove your broken key from the ignition.

    If your car key won't turn on, it might be damaged or has an issue with the anti-theft device. If you have a spare, try it to see if the key works. If it does, have the one you have repaired or replaced.

    If your key doesn't be able to enter the ignition, it could be time to call an auto locksmith in your area for assistance. They can use locks from automobiles to open your door so they'll be able to access your ignition cylinder and make any repairs needed. Depending on the severity of the damage is, they might recommend replacing the entire switch. This could be costly.

    Lost Keys

    Every car owner or driver hates the thought of locking the keys in the car. It can be even more stressful if it happens in a rush or when the weather is extremely (very hot or very cold). A dependable NYC automotive locksmith is competent to assist you through this stressful time.

    Most people don't know that the local auto locksmith can also make them new keys if they lose their keys. This service is often cheaper and faster than visiting the dealership. Additionally, a reputable locksmith will keep their prices low and will be honest about all charges. They'll also have the right tools and equipment to unlock your car without damaging it or making any unnecessary repairs.

    The cost of replacing a car key is dependent on the kind of key you have and whether it requires transponder chips or not. The best method to figure out the cost is to call a variety of auto locksmiths in your area and compare their prices and reviews. Some have flat rates while others charge by the hour. The cost can also vary depending on the timing of the day, as certain locksmiths charge a higher rate for emergency services.

    A damaged key is another common problem that can be solved by an automotive locksmith. It can be difficult trying to remove the key from the lock, without causing damage. This is especially true for older cars that have more complex locks and require special tools to open them.

    local automotive locksmith locksmiths are well-trained to deal with this issue quickly. They'll employ special tools to take out broken pieces of the key, without removing any parts of the vehicle's body. Additionally, they'll be able to cut a new key for you, which will allow you to start your car again.

    It's a good idea to keep a spare key in your vehicle. It's especially helpful when you share a room with a friend or have children who sometimes forget where they've put their own keys. You could also request your local locksmith to program a spare which will make it easier for you to gain access to your vehicle should you lock yourself out or lose your car keys.

    Transponder keys can be a great addition to cars however they can cause problems if damaged or lost. This happens because the key fob is programmed to connect with your car's immobilizer. The car will not start if this does not happen. A local auto locksmith will rekey the lock of your vehicle to stop anyone from using the old key.

    Transponder keys are typically found in the head mold. These key chips send signals to the computer in the car when they are used.
